Question
How many 4d electrons can have spin quantum number $-\frac{1}{2}?$ Explain.

Answer

Five 4d electrons can have spin quantum number $-\frac{1}{2}$ because there are total 10 electrons in d-orbitals, out of which five will have $+\frac{1}{2}$ and other five will have $-\frac{1}{2}$ spin quantum numbers.
